Description

Daiginjo Shukondeinoshirokamutachi is a celebratory daiginjo from the Noshiro brewery in Akita, with a poetic name evoking the white deity or spirit of Noshiro. Extensive rice polishing yields a light, fragrant, and elegantly structured brew that exemplifies the prestige tier of Japanese sake from the Tohoku tradition.

Kikusui Shuzo Co.

Akita
It is used as a storage for storing and managing sake such as Ginjo sake by repairing the old JNR's waste tunnel. In addition to sake, there are shochu made from sake lees.
